About

Explore and experience the best of West Hollywood & Beverly Hills on your own time, at your own pace. This unique self-guided bike tour takes you where the tour buses can’t. It’s a “whenever-you-feel-like-it tour” – you pick the date and time that is most convenient then you’re off on your own LA bike tour.

Once you step in the door, you'll be set up with high-quality multi-speed push-pedal city bikes and we'll direct you to LA’s highlights, hotspots, and hidden gems, just like an in-person guide would do. Or, for an extra $25, you upgrade to pedal-assist electric bikes! You’ll pedal down the quaint streets of West Hollywood and over to the glamorous palm tree lined streets of Beverly Hills where you might catch a glimpse of a celebrity or two.

When you’re ready for a break, just hop off your bike, lock it up, and have a fabulous lunch at one the many LA restaurants and cafes. Take a stroll down Rodeo Drive for a little shopping or relax in a Beverly Hills park for a bit.

How it Works

Book your tour. When you arrive, you'll sign our waiver, we'll send you a link to the digital map to open on your device (you'll need available data on your phone), we'll set you up with your gear, and you're off on your tour. You'll have your bikes for up to 4 hours to explore the city.

Fitness Level: Easy to Moderate with some hills but nothing to worry about (it's called Beverly Hills for a reason). You must be comfortable on a bike. Tour Includes: High-End multi-speed push pedal bike, helmet, safety vest, and digital map. Upgrade to an electric bike for $25 per person and zoom up those hills with ease!
